Dark fleet bunkering highlights weakness of sanctions systems against Russia

Nov 12, 2025 12:37

The two bunker tankers 'Rina' and 'Zircone' (IMO: 9010929) were still supplying the Russian shadow fleet, operating primarily from the ports of Riga, Klaipeda and Paldiski, and their pattern of activity has changed little, notwithstanding the increasing isolation of Russia post its invasion of Ukraine in 2022. A large percentage of thetankers's customers at sea remained Russian-owned tankers on their way to and from the Russian oil export terminals at Primorsk and Ust-Luga. Most of these tankers are now members of Russian-controlled dark fleet, sailing under fast-changing flags of convenience and switching names frequently. On March 11, 2025, the 'Rina' was bunkering the tanker 'Blue' (IMO: 9236353), then flying the flag of Antigua and Barbuda and apparently Turkish-owned. On Oct 30, the 'Blue' was bunkered by the 'Zircone' off Gotland. On Aug 17, 2024, the tanker 'Rainbow' (IMO 9302126), also then flying the flag of Antigua and Barbuda, was refueled by the 'Zircone' off Gotland, and when plying between Primorsk and Libya, was refueled by the 'Rina' on Dec 14. Neither the 'Blue' or the 'Rainbow' were sanctioned when they were bunkered on these occasions. But like many other customers, they were sanctioned later, and their series of visits to Primorsk and Ust-Luga should have raised compliance red flags. An investigation found that between June 2024 and March 2025, the 'Rina' and 'Zircone' bunkered 286 ships. Of these, more than 160 were tankers which had called at Primorsk and Ust-Luga either before or after the bunkering rendezvous. Since the operations of the 'Rina' and 'Zircone' began to attract publicity, their ownership has changed and has finally settled on a company registered in Dubai, namely FB Trade DWC-LLC (Commercial Registration 11119), though they were still operating in the Baltic. FB Trade was now also believed to be operating the tanker 'Onyx 2' (IMO: 9169782), flagged in the Comoros Islands. wjocj appeared to be conducting bunkering operations in the Gulf of Oman out of Khor Fakkan, off which there were STS transshipment hub frequented by both Russian and Iranian dark fleet tankers. illustrating the inherent weakness of the sanctions system: Estonia and Latvia are amongst the most active nations seeking to curb the Russian aggression, but have not been able to curtail activities based in their ports, nor have Denmark or Sweden, also closely committed to increasing pressure on Russia, been able to clamp down on dark fleet-associated activities in their home waters. In the Gulf, countries bordering what used to be called the Pirate Coast are in general disinclined to intervene.
